WebSep 9, 2024 · Fill the buffer tank with 1X Electrophoresis buffer, ensuring that the entire gel is completely submerged. You want about 1 mm liquid layer above the gel, but not too much buffer as that can build up resistance. Check that the gel is oriented with sample wells closest to the negative electrode (black). Such GC-rich regions affect the generation … WebAgarose Gel Electrophoresis To check PCR products, restriction digests, etc.. Generally use a 1% gel. For separating fragments that are 500bp or smaller, use 2% agarose. If the downstream application is DNA extraction, use 0.7% agarose. Pour a 1% gel. Volumes are: Smalllest gel box (blue) = 20ml; 0.2g agarose

PCR products can range up to 10kb in length, but the majority … photography cyprusWebHow much DNA should be loaded per well of an agarose gel? The amount of DNA to load per well is variable. The least amount of DNA that can be detected with ethidum bromide is 10 ng.
